Web26 jul. 2024 · If kept frozen continuously, chicken will be safe indefinitely, so after freezing, it’s not important if any package dates expire. For best quality, taste and texture, keep whole raw chicken in the freezer up to one year; parts, 9 months; and giblets or ground chicken, 3 to 4 months Can you freeze raw bone in chicken? Web1 jan. 2024 · The USDA recommends using thawed chicken within 1-2 days, although it can be safely kept in the fridge for up to 3-4 days if handled properly. It is important to keep the chicken in a covered container and to store it in the coldest part of the fridge, such as the bottom shelf or in the meat drawer. WebThis article’s main point is that cooked chicken can sit at room temperature for up to 2 hours. However, if the room temperature is around 90 degrees F, 1 hour would be too much before it turns bad.
